What is the difference between Volunteer Novant Health Rn vs Volunteer Novant Health Lpn?

AspectVolunteer Novant Health RnVolunteer Novant Health Lpn
CertificationsRegistered Nurse (RN) licenseLicensed Practical Nurse (LPN) license
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, patient care unitsLong-term care, outpatient clinics, some hospital areas
Roles & ResponsibilitiesAssess patient needs, develop care plans, administer medicationsAssist with basic patient care, monitor vital signs, support RNs

Both Volunteer Novant Health Rn and Volunteer Novant Health Lpn roles involve supporting patient care within healthcare settings. RNs typically have broader responsibilities, including assessments and care planning, while LPNs focus on basic patient support. The main difference lies in their licensing requirements and scope of practice, with RNs holding a registered nurse license and LPNs holding a practical nurse license.

What You'll Do
  • Lead and support the healthcare team in delivering exceptional patient care in an ambulatory setting
  • Triage and manage incoming patient calls to ensure timely and appropriate follow up
  • Room patients, prepare them for provider visits, and assist with in-office procedures
  • Build authentic, personalized relationships with patients and their chosen support systems
  • Collaborate with physicians and interdisciplinary teams to create and manage individualized care plans regarding labs, imaging, and referrals
  • Provide patient education and perioperative support including pre-op instructions, post op-care, and discharge teaching
  • Apply best scientific evidence and clinical expertise to guide nursing decisions
  • Advocate for patients while ensuring safe, compassionate, and high-quality care-supporting both physical outcomes and patient confidence
  • Take ownership and accountability for the coordination and delivery of nursing care, with attention to detail and patient experience

If your RN nursing license has been inactive, retired or lapsed for five years or more and you have not been licensed in another state during the last five years, successful completion of a Board approved refresher course is required prior to reactivating or reinstating your license. In order to be considered for current licensure status, you must apply for reinstatement within one year of completing the refresher course.

Novant Health is a not-for-profit integrated system of 16 medical centers and more than 1,900 physicians in over 800 locations, as well as numerous outpatient surgery centers, medical plazas, rehabilitation programs, diagnostic imaging centers and community health outreach programs. Novant Health's more than 36,000 team members and physician partners care for patients and communities in North Carolina and South Carolina.
